Installation of 8SU (6LH, 9BH) and 8U (6AH, 9CH) Bulldozer{6051, 6053} Caterpillar


Installation of 8SU (6LH, 9BH) and 8U (6AH, 9CH) Bulldozer{6051, 6053}

Usage:

D8N (5TJ, 7TK) Track-Type Tractors

Introduction

This Special Instruction gives the procedure for installation of the lift cylinders and the 8S and 8U Bulldozers with a single tilt cylinder.

NOTE: Each section contains the related parts list.

After the assembly is complete, prepare the machine for service as shown in the machine's Operation & Maintenance Manual.

Do not perform any procedure outlined in this publication, or order any parts, until you read and understand the information contained within.

Reference: Service Manual, Parts Manual and Operation & Maintenance Manual.

Shimming Procedure


Illustration 1.
Typical Example

1. Remove all the shims from assembly (1).

2. Install assembly (1) and cap (2) on trunnion (3) without the shims. Tighten the bolts until snug using five percent of the specified joint torque or 50 N·m (37 lb ft), which ever is larger. Maintain equal distance on both (A) and (B) of cap (2).

3. Insert an equal amount of shims as needed into spaces (A) and (B), between the cap and the assembly.

NOTE: The number of shims at (A) must be equal to, or within one of the number of shims at (B). For example, if (A) has eight shims, (B) must have seven, eight or nine shims.

4. Add one additional shim to space (A) and one additional shim to space (B).

5. Tighten the cap to the proper torque.

6. This should allow the assembly to move on the trunnion freely and within the specified tolerance (0.25 mm minimum).

NOTE: It may be necessary to remove one or more shims after a short time of "Wear In" due to normal surface variations or paint thicknesses.

Installation of Lift Cylinders

Necessary Parts

NOTE: Clean all surfaces where parts are to be installed, including removal of paint from mating surfaces.

Installation Procedure for 8E-6153 and 6I-8788 Cylinder Mounting Groups


Illustration 2.
(C) 6Y-5693 Yoke does not have this tang.

NOTE: Remove shipping covers and plugs from radiator guard housing.

1. Lubricate seal (1) with multipurpose type grease. Install seal (1) in radiator guard housing with the lips to the outside.

2. Pack cylinder group mounting bearing bores in radiator guard housing with multipurpose type grease.

3. Install yoke (2) in radiator guard housing. Lock yoke (2) in place with pin (3).

NOTE: Remove cover (A) and bolts (B) to install pin (3). Install cover (A) and bolts (B) after pin (3) is installed.

4. Install fitting (5) in radiator guard housing.

5. Pack cap assemblies (4) with multipurpose type grease.

6. Install cap assemblies (4) on trunnions of cylinder group (7).

7. Mount cylinder group (7) and cap assemblies (4) on yoke (2) with four bolts (6). Tighten bolts (6) to a torque of 370 ± 50 N·m (272 ± 37 lb ft).

8. Repeat Steps 1 through 7 for the other side of the machine.

NOTE: Steps 9 and 10 are for shipping purposes only.

9. Install plate (8) to radiator guard housing with washer (9) and bolt (10). Tighten bolt (10) to a torque of 105 ± 20 N·m (77 ± 15 lb ft).

NOTE: Install plate (8) on the left side of the machine, using a bolt from the tilt cylinder lines group (manifold) that comes with the machine.

10. Assemble clips (11) and (12) to cylinder group (7) and plate (8) with two washers (9), bolt (13) and nut (14). Tighten bolt (13) to a torque of 105 ± 20 N·m (77 ± 15 lb ft).

11. Repeat Steps 9 and 10 for the other side of the machine.

NOTE: For installation of the 6I-8788 cylinder mounting group, item (14) requires two washers and a nut.


Illustration 3.

NOTE: Remove shipping covers and seals from manifold on radiator guard housing and lift cylinders (7).

12. Install connector (15) with seal (16) to cylinder group (7).

13. Connect hose assembly (17) to connector (15) on cylinder group (7) with seal (18).

14. Install connector (19) to cylinder group (7) with seal (20).

15. Install tube assembly (21) to connector (19) with seal (22).

16. Connect hose assembly (23) to tube assembly (21) with seal (24), two flanges (25), two washers (26) and two bolts (27). Tighten bolts (27) to a torque of 47 ± 9 N·m (35 ± 7 lb ft).

17. Install bracket assembly (28) to flanges (25) on tube assembly (21) with two washers (26) and two bolts (29). Tighten bolts (29) to a torque of 47 ± 9 N·m (35 ± 7 lb ft).

18. Install plate assembly (30) to cylinder group (7) and bracket assembly (28) with six washers (31), four bolts (32) and two bolts (33). Tighten bolts (32) and (33) to a torque of 47 ± 9 N·m (35 ± 7 lb ft).

19. Connect the other ends of hose assemblies (17) and (23) to manifold on radiator guard housing with two seals (24), four flanges, eight washers and eight bolts.

NOTE: The items not numbered are part of the lines group that comes with the machine.

20. Install grommets (34) and (35) to hose assemblies (17) and (23) with spacer (36), washer (37), bolt (38) and locknut (39). Tighten bolt (38) to a torque of 6 ± 1 N·m (4 ± .74 lb ft).

21. Repeat Steps 12 through 20 for the other side of the machine.

Installation of Trunnions

Necessary Parts

Installation Procedure


Illustration 4.
Typical Example

Starting on one side:

1. Remove shipping cover (1) from the track roller frame.


Illustration 5.
Typical Example

2. Remove plug (3) and move plate (2) in towards the center of the machine as far as possible. Install plug (3) back in the plate.


Illustration 6.

NOTE: Step 2 eliminates the hydraulic pressure that forms between seal plate (2) and pivot shaft retainer plate (A). This step also allows adequate clearance between trunnion assembly (4) and plate (2).


Illustration 7.
Typical Example

3. Install the guide pins [same thread size as bolts being installed, approximately 203 mm (8 in) in length] in the track roller frame.


Illustration 8.
Typical Example

4. Start trunnion assembly (4) on the guide pins.


Illustration 9.
Typical Example

5. Install trunnion assembly (4) with 16 washers (5) and bolts (6).

6. Tighten bolts (6) to a torque of 240 ± 40 N·m (180 ± 30 lb ft).

7. Repeat Steps 1 through 6 for other side of the machine.

Assembly and Installation of Bulldozer (With Single Tilt)

Necessary Parts

NOTE: All hardware is metric.

Assembly Procedure


Illustration 10.
Typical Example (earlier model shown)

1. Raise and block the bulldozer blade in an upright position.


Illustration 11.
Grind relief on boss (E).

NOTE: On some models the 8E-6155 bracket assembly (D) [on the right side of blade, at the tilt cylinder connection] used a boss (E) [on inside of 8e-6155 bracket assembly (D)] that had a small corner radius instead of a full round radius. See Illustration 11. If you have a boss (E) that has a small corner radius, grind relief (F) as shown in Illustration 11 to prevent interference between tilt cylinder rod eye and boss (E). If boss (E) is round, no grinding should be required.


Illustration 12.

2. Install connector assembly (1) to the bulldozer blade with pin (2), retainer (4) and two bolts (5). Tighten bolts (5) to a torque of 900 ± 100 N·m (660 ± 75 lb ft).


Illustration 13.

3. Install arm group (6) to the bulldozer blade with pin (7), retainer (8) and two bolts (9). Tighten bolts (9) to a torque of 900 ± 100 N·m (660 ± 75 lb ft).

4. Repeat Steps 2 and 3 for the other side of the machine.


Illustration 14.

5. On the right side, install cylinder group (12) to the bulldozer blade with pin (3), retainer (4) and two bolts (5). Tighten bolts (5) to a torque of 900 ± 100 N·m (660 ± 75 lb ft).


Illustration 15.

6. Install cylinder group (12) to right arm group (6) with pin (11), retainer (8) and two bolts (9). Tighten bolts (9) to a torque of 900 ± 100 N·m (660 ± 75 lb ft).


Illustration 16.
Screw Tilt Brace Version
(X) 1235 mm (48.6 in).

7. On the left side, install brace group (10) to the bulldozer blade with pin (3), retainer (4) and two bolts (5). Tighten bolts (5) to a torque of 900 ± 100 N·m (660 ± 75 lb ft).

NOTE: Adjust brace group (10) to neutral dimension (X) before installation to arm group.

NOTE: Do not adjust the brace beyond the extended position, [X = 1285.0 mm (50.59 in)]. Damage to the lift cylinder may occur if adjustment X is greater than [1285.0 mm (50.59 in)].

NOTE: Apply a heavy coating of multipurpose type grease to the threaded surfaces on brace group (10).


Illustration 17.
Screw Tilt Brace Version

8. Install brace group (10) to left arm group (6) with pin (11), retainer (8) and two bolts (9). Tighten bolts (9) to a torque of 900 ± 100 N·m (660 ± 75 lb ft).


Illustration 18.
Three-position Tilt Brace Version

8A. Install the bearing end of the brace assembly (2) to the bulldozer blade with pin (8), retainer (6) and two bolts (5). Tighten bolts (5) to a torque of 900 ± 100 N·m (662 ± 74 lb ft).

NOTE: Left push arm (6) has been modified for "Three-Position Tilt Brace Version" using bracket assembly (1), plate (3) and gusset (4). See Special Instruction SEHS9740, "Conversion To Three-Position Tilt Brace", for further information about modification.


Illustration 19.
Three-position Tilt Brace Version

8B. Align the brace assembly (2) to center hole (A) of bracket assembly (1) on left push arm (6) and insert pin (7). Fasten pin (7) with retainer (6) and two bolts (5). The center hole (A) of bracket assembly (1) is neutral position. Tighten bolts (5) to a torque of 900 ± 100 N·m (662 ± 74 lb ft).


Illustration 20.

9. Install link group (13) to the blade assembly with cap, shims, four bolts and four nuts. See the topic entitled "Shimming Procedure" in this Special Instruction for shimming instructions.

NOTE: The items not numbered are part of link group (13).


Illustration 21.
Typical Example (earlier model shown)

10. Install tube assembly (14) to cylinder group (12) with seal (15), four washers (16) and four bolts (17). Tighten bolts (17) to a torque of 60 ± 12 N·m (44 ± 9 lb ft). Secure tube assembly (14) to cylinder group (12) with washer (18) and bolt (19). Tighten bolt (19) to a torque of 105 ± 20 N·m (75 ± 15 lb ft).


Illustration 22.

11. Insert two hose assemblies (20) into link group (13).

NOTE: Assemble plates (21) with the part number visible.

12. Connect the hose assemblies on the blade end of the link group to the under side of plate (21) with two seals (15), four flanges (22), eight washers (23) and eight bolts (24). Tighten bolts (24) to a torque of 60 ± 12 N·m (44 ± 9 lb ft).

NOTE: Hardware on top of plate (21) can be started for later hose assembly installation.


Illustration 23.
(A) Rod end. (B) Head end.

13. Install plate (21) to the link group with four washers (18) and four bolts (25). Tighten bolts (25) to a torque of 105 ± 20 N·m (75 ± 15 lb ft).

14. Connect two hose assemblies (26) to plate (21) (blade end) with two seals (15), four flanges (22), eight washers (23) and eight bolts (24). Tighten bolts (24) to a torque of 60 ± 12 N·m (44 ± 9 lb ft).

15. Install the other ends of hose assemblies (26) to tilt cylinder (12) with two seals (15), four flanges (22), eight washers (23) and eight bolts (24). Tighten bolts (24) to a torque of 60 ± 12 N·m (44 ± 9 lb ft).


Illustration 24.

16. On the machine end of link group (13), connect the other ends of hose assemblies (20) to the under side of plate (21) with two seals (15), four flanges (22), eight washers (23) and eight bolts (24). Tighten bolts (24) to a torque of 60 ± 12 N·m (44 ± 9 lb ft).

NOTE: Hardware on top of plate (21) can be started for later hose assembly installation.


Illustration 25.
(A) Rod end. (B) Head end.

17. Install plate (21) to link group (13) with four washers (18) and four bolts (25). Tighten bolts (25) to a torque of 105 ± 20 N·m (75 ± 15 lb ft).

18. Connect hose assembly (27) and hose assembly (28) to plate (21) (machine end) with two seals (15), four flanges (22), eight washers (23) and eight bolts (24). Tighten bolts (24) to a torque of 60 ± 12 N·m (44 ± 9 lb ft).


Illustration 26.

19. Install guard (29) to the tilt cylinder group with four washers (30), two bolts (31) and two nuts (32). Tighten bolts (31) to a torque of 270 ± 40 N·m (200 ± 30 lb ft).


Illustration 27.

20. Install guard (33) to link group (13) (blade end) with four washers (30), two bolts (34) and two nuts (32). Tighten bolts (34) to a torque of 270 ± 40 N·m (200 ± 30 lb ft).

NOTE: Assemble bolts (34) with the bolt heads on the blade side.


Illustration 28.

21. Loosen two bolts (C) on each end of plate (21). Install guard (35) to the plate and link group (machine end) with two washers (18) and two bolts (19).

Tighten bolts (C) and (19) to a torque of 105 ± 20 N·m (75 ± 15 lb ft).

Installation Procedure


Illustration 29.

1. Block push arms (6) to the height of the machine trunnions (see arrows).

2. Move the machine into the push arms. Turn off engine.


Illustration 30.

3. Install cap on push arm (6) with shims, two bolts and two nuts. See the topic entitled "Shimming Procedure" in this Special Instruction for shimming instructions. Tighten bolts to a torque of 1800 ± 200 N·m (1324 ± 147 lb ft).

NOTE: The items not numbered are part of the push arm group.

4. Repeat Step 3 for the other side of the machine.


Illustration 31.

5. Install link group (13) to the machine trunnion (see arrow) with shims, cap, four bolts and four nuts. See the topic entitled "Shimming Procedure" in this Special Instruction for shimming instructions.

NOTE: The items not numbered are part of link group (13).


Illustration 32.
(A) Rod end. (B) Head end.

NOTE: Remove shipping covers from the working ports on the manifold.

6. Connect hose assembly (27) and hose assembly (28) to the manifold with two seals (15), four flanges, eight washers and eight bolts. Tighten bolts to a torque of 60 ± 12 N·m (44 ± 9 lb ft).

NOTE: The items not numbered are part of the tilt cylinder lines group.


Illustration 33.

7. On each side, install lift cylinders (see arrow) to the bulldozer blade with cap, shims, four bolts and four nuts. See the topic entitled "Shimming Procedure" in this Special Instruction for shimming instructions.

NOTE: The items not numbered are part of the lift cylinder group.

8. Check oil in hydraulic tank and fill if necessary. Cycle cylinders full stroke in both directions to purge air from lines and cylinders. Refill hydraulic tank to full mark.

9. After the assembly is complete, get the machine ready for use as shown in the machine's Operation & Maintenance Manual.
